Output 8496f423faa11768f3a51a0a754d3c38fabf839e7fd87bb24f679cce5334071b:1

value
79320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a984924107cf5455c02d6a051da44e0a4c5d8c OP_EQUAL
address
34aRwoDbh3RcVY2kzmeXkV7vE12FfNkQQe
transaction
8496f423faa11768f3a51a0a754d3c38fabf839e7fd87bb24f679cce5334071b
spent
true